Daily Feast – July 1

Set your Mind on Victory

Set your mind on things above, not on things on the earth. - Colossians 3:2

Beloved, learn to focus on the bright side of life. Don't see what the enemy is doing, focus on what God is doing to recognize the opportunities that God is creating for you. Two men were sent to a country to see the opportunity to sell shoes there. One of them said; 'They don't wear shoes there. So, no need to ship in shoes'. The other man said; 'They don't wear shoes here. So, send me a shipload of shoes'. It is what you see about life that becomes your experience. Make up your mind to enjoy your life; don't wait for things to change.

Set your heart on the good things that God is doing. Don't go out expecting problems. On the sand of history are thousands of men who have refused to go, and in not going, they died, because when you stop going, you will start dying. Therefore, be enthusiastic, set your mind on victory. Enlarge your vision and refuse to give up on your dreams. The bible says that David encouraged himself when circumstances looked so bleak.

There are times in life that no one is there to encourage you but you must encourage yourself in the Lord. Commit to celebrating. You must stand your ground. Don't lose the ground that God has given you. Anything you cannot confront, you cannot conquer. So, confront your issues. Your story will succeed.

Thanksgiving can be a sacrifice. Everybody can sing when things are working. But when you have not seen the outcome, your praises become a sacrifice. Jonah was already praising God in the belly of a fish. He prophesied his deliverance then God commanded the fish to vomit him. So, praise God amidst difficulties and the situation will turn around for your good. Sing in your midnight. Midnight represents a season of pain, troubles, and opposition. Paul and Silas sang when their backs were bleeding for doing the will of God. So, learn to turn the place of struggle and defeat into a place of thanksgiving. You can activate God's power through praises and turn the place of defeat into a place of victory.

Prayer: Poverty rules where opportunities are not discovered; so oh Lord, open my eyes to see opportunity. I receive insight to see the treasures of darkness and let every lost grounds in my life experience restoration In Jesus Name.

Further Reading: 1 Samuel 30:6; Psalm 107:22; Jonah 2:8-10; Acts 16:22-27
